Home
last modified time | relevance | path

Searched refs:ShifterOperandCanHold (Results 1 – 6 of 6) sorted by relevance

/art/compiler/utils/arm/
Dassembler_thumb2.cc28 bool Thumb2Assembler::ShifterOperandCanHold(Register rd ATTRIBUTE_UNUSED, in ShifterOperandCanHold() function in art::arm::Thumb2Assembler
2472 if (ShifterOperandCanHold(rd, rn, ADD, value, &shifter_op)) { in AddConstant()
2474 } else if (ShifterOperandCanHold(rd, rn, SUB, -value, &shifter_op)) { in AddConstant()
2478 if (ShifterOperandCanHold(rd, rn, MVN, ~value, &shifter_op)) { in AddConstant()
2481 } else if (ShifterOperandCanHold(rd, rn, MVN, ~(-value), &shifter_op)) { in AddConstant()
2499 if (ShifterOperandCanHold(rd, rn, ADD, value, &shifter_op)) { in AddConstantSetFlags()
2501 } else if (ShifterOperandCanHold(rd, rn, ADD, -value, &shifter_op)) { in AddConstantSetFlags()
2505 if (ShifterOperandCanHold(rd, rn, MVN, ~value, &shifter_op)) { in AddConstantSetFlags()
2508 } else if (ShifterOperandCanHold(rd, rn, MVN, ~(-value), &shifter_op)) { in AddConstantSetFlags()
2525 if (ShifterOperandCanHold(rd, R0, MOV, value, &shifter_op)) { in LoadImmediate()
[all …]
Dassembler_arm32.h277 bool ShifterOperandCanHold(Register rd,
Dassembler_thumb2.h316 bool ShifterOperandCanHold(Register rd,
Dassembler_arm.h644 virtual bool ShifterOperandCanHold(Register rd,
Dassembler_arm32.cc51 bool Arm32Assembler::ShifterOperandCanHold(Register rd ATTRIBUTE_UNUSED, in ShifterOperandCanHold() function in art::arm::Arm32Assembler
/art/compiler/optimizing/
Dcode_generator_arm.cc972 if (GetAssembler()->ShifterOperandCanHold(R0, left, CMP, value, &operand)) { in GenerateTestAndBranch()
1051 if (GetAssembler()->ShifterOperandCanHold(R0, left, CMP, value, &operand)) { in VisitCondition()